What does a mechanical engineer recent grad do?

A Mechanical Engineer Recent Grad assists in designing, developing, and testing mechanical systems or products. They typically work on tasks such as creating technical drawings, running simulations, conducting experiments, and supporting senior engineers in project work. Recent grads often work in industries like automotive, aerospace, manufacturing, or energy, gaining hands-on experience and building their engineering skills. They also coll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, learn industry standards, and may help troubleshoot mechanical problems. This role serves as a foundation for professional growth and prepares them for more advanced engineering responsibilities.

What types of projects can a recent graduate in mechanical engineering expect to work on during their first year?

As a recent graduate, you can expect to be involved in a variety of entry-level projects such as assisting with product design, performing basic calculations and simulations, supporting prototype development, and preparing technical documentation. You'll often collaborate with senior engineers and cross-functional teams—including manufacturing, quality assurance, and procurement—to gain exposure to different aspects of the engineering process. This hands-on experience is designed to build your technical skills, familiarize you with industry standards, and prepare you for more complex responsibilities as you advance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a mechanical engineer recent grad,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Mechanical Engineer Recent Grad, you need a solid understanding of engineering principles, proficiency in mathematics, and a bachelor's degree in mechanical engineering or a related field. Familiarity with CAD software such as SolidWorks or AutoCAD, and experience with simulation tools like ANSYS, are typically required, along with knowledge of industry standards. Strong probl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and effective communication help distinguish you in collaborative and fast-paced environments. These skills and qualities are vital to successfully design, analyze, and implement engineering solutions that meet project and industry requirements.

Job description

About Us

T/E/S Engineering is made up of experienced designers, dedicated engineers, professional project managers, skilled support staff, and ambitious salespeople. We are a growing consulting engineering firm in Westlake, OH. Multiple-time winner of theNorthCoast99 Award for best places to work, winner of the Leading-Edge Award, and 5-time winners of the Inc.5000 Fastest-Growing Companies. We design the mechanical, electrical, and plumbing systems that make buildings live and breathe for the people who use them. Our clients are diverse and include national accounts. Our client sectors primarily include Food Service, Retail, Office, Hospitality, Assisted Living, Childcare, K-12, Industrial, Institutional, and Entertainment.


Culture

Our company does things differently. Our culture allows us to accomplish exceptional customer focus while sustaining a strong team with strong people – both in and out of the office.


MECHANICAL ENGINEER—EXPERIENCED OR ENTRY-LEVEL

We seek a qualified Mechanical Engineer who shares our beliefs about client service to join our mechanical engineering department.


Responsibilities include:

  • HVAC load calculations and equipment selections for commercial building heating and cooling equipment.
  • Air distribution design and hydronic system design for HVAC systems.
  • Research and comply with local, state, and federal mechanical and energy codes and standards.
  • Produce mechanical specifications for HVAC systems and designs.
  • Proficiency in CAD and Revit standards for the generation of mechanical documents.
  • Effectively and proactively communicate with project managers, project engineers, and field foremen during the design, drafting, and construction process.


Desired experience ranges from recent grad to 5 or more years of demonstrated experience with mechanical design in the building and construction industry (experience determines compensation); a BSME; and robust AutoCAD proficiency, preferably with Revit experience. PE designation is preferred, assistance may be offered to achieve.
